Commercial Gutter Maintenance in Denver County, CO
Commercial gutter maintenance services involve inspecting, cleaning, and repairing gutter systems on various types of commercial properties, including retail centers, office buildings, and industrial facilities. These services typically address projects such as removing debris, clearing blockages, checking for leaks or damage, and ensuring gutters are functioning properly to direct water away from the building’s foundation. Property owners often seek this maintenance to prevent water damage, reduce the risk of flooding, and preserve the structural integrity of their buildings,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or snow.
Before requesting commercial gutter maintenance, property owners should consider the size and type of their gutter system, as well as any specific concerns like persistent clogging or visible damage. It’s helpful to understand the scope of work needed, such as whether repairs are required in addition to cleaning, and to identify any access challenges that might affect the service. Clarifying these details can ensure the maintenance is thorough and tailored to the property's needs, helping to maintain the property's value and safety.

Common Commercial Gutter Maintenance Jobs
Commercial gutter maintenance ensures that gutters are clear and functioning properly to protect building foundations. - Regular inspections help identify and address potential clogging or damage early. - Gutter cleaning removes debris that can cause water backups and overflow. - Downspout checks ensure proper water flow away from the building’s foundation. - Repairs and sealing prevent leaks and extend the lifespan of gutter systems. - Gutter system upgrades can improve drainage efficiency and reduce maintenance needs.
Commercial Gutter Maintenance Questions
What is commercial gutter maintenance? It involves inspecting, cleaning, and repairing gutters on commercial properties to ensure proper water flow and prevent damage.
Why is regular gutter maintenance important for commercial buildings? Regular maintenance helps prevent water damage, foundation issues, and structural deterioration caused by clogged or damaged gutters.
What types of commercial properties typically need gutter maintenance? Office buildings, retail centers, industrial facilities, and multi-family residential complexes often require routine gutter upkeep.
What services are included in commercial gutter maintenance? Services typically include debris removal, gutter and downspout cleaning, minor repairs, and system inspections for proper functioning.
